Output 84e4a530c3b4e204481ab59b235d09a65cbaef6aafdb1aaac92ac3e2c757c36a:1

value
1514464
script pubkey
OP_0 OP_PUSHBYTES_20 ccfbeedf7b7df5d052077277057627a9bcf0895d
address
ltc1qena7ahmm0h6aq5s8wfms2a384x70pz2a93xwah
transaction
84e4a530c3b4e204481ab59b235d09a65cbaef6aafdb1aaac92ac3e2c757c36a
spent
true